Postsecondary Home Economics Teacher Salary in Dallas-Fort Worth-Arlington, Texas

The annual salary statistics of postsecondary home economics teachers in Dallas-Fort Worth-Arlington, Texas is shown in Table 1. The wage statistics of postsecondary home economics teachers in Dallas-Fort Worth-Arlington is based on the national compensation survey conducted by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ics in 2022 and published in April 2023 [1].

Table 1. Annual Salary of Postsecondary Home Economics Teachers in Dallas-Fort Worth-Arlington, Texas

Percentile BracketAverage Annual Salary
10th Percentile Wage
$29,840
25th Percentile Wage
$55,400
50th Percentile Wage
$71,220
75th Percentile Wage
$139,450
90th Percentile Wage
$155,990

Table 1 shows the average annual salary for postsecondary home economics teachers in Dallas-Fort Worth-Arlington, Texas in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) is $155,990. The median (50th percentile) annual salary is $71,220.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ent earners is $29,840.

Table 2. Compare Postsecondary Home Economics Teacher Salary in Dallas-Fort Worth-Arlington with Other Texas Cities

From Table 3 we note that with a median annual salary of $71,220, Dallas-Fort Worth-Arlington is the highest paying city for postsecondary home economics teachers in state of Texas, followed by Waco (median annual salary $70,050). In comparison, the median annual salary of postsecondary home economics teachers in Dallas-Fort Worth-Arlington is 1.6 percent (1.6%) higher than that in Waco.

Cities/Areas Median Annual Salary
Dallas-Fort Worth-Arlington
$71,220
Waco
$70,050
Austin-Round Rock-San Marcos
$57,270
Fort Worth-Arlington
$52,410
Houston-Sugar Land-Baytown
$34,930
